Inclusion criteria

Inclusion criteria: Group 1 (dystonia): evidence of cervical dystonia by a specialist for Neurology, exclusion of other causes for dystonia-like symptomes, right-handed, no other neurological diseases, no pre-medication, MRI compatibility Group 2 (spasticity): evidence of clinically significant spasticity of the right side of the body following an ischemic infarction by a media, right-handed, no other neurological diseases, no relevant pre-medication, MRI compatibility

Exclusion criteria

Exclusion criteria: Psychiatric comorbidity, counter indication for MRI

Design outcomes

Primary

MeasureTime frame
Treatment response in group 1 (dystonia) and group 2 (spasticity) after 12 months under treatment with botulinum toxin: - Dystonia: UDRS (Unified Dystonia Rating Scale), TWSTRS (Toronto Western Spasmodic Torticollis Rating Scale) - Spasticity: MAS (Mod Ashworth scale), SERS (Spasticity Examination Rating Scale)

Secondary

MeasureTime frame
Pain reduction (interview with "German Pain Questionnaire") at 0, 3 and 12 months
